I still plan on coming, I have nothing to tune myself so I will be able to help out the other guys. Just a couple notes, if you want a chip burnt for simple changes, at the very least have a chip with you. I would also reccomend a moates adapter so you can easily put the chip to use. Nothing major here, I don't feel comfortable altering your tune and you shouldn't feel comfortable with me altering your tune. For those of you that want to use the WB, you will need a bung welded in your I-pipe, somewhere between your cat and the y. Don't want to mess around pulling your stock o2 out, my wiring isn't long enough anyway. Datalogging through the ECM is the best method of getting your readings, but this requires you to splice into your ECM for the WB output and ground and have your prom changed. A VOM will work, but it will be ballpark. I'm sure the other tuners can throw something in here.
